Tom Jones / directed by Georgia Parris.
Abandoned as a baby, rescued and adopted by a country gentleman, Tom Jones grows up kind, handsome, free-spirited, and very popular with the ladies. But he cannot escape his lowly birth. When he falls in love with the bright, beautiful heiress Sophia Western, and she falls in love with him, their families unite against the match. They both end up in London, facing the wiles and whims of Sophia's aunt, the beguiling but dangerous Lady Bellaston, who will stop at nothing to destroy their love. Can Tom ever convince Sophia that he can be true to her? In this classic romantic comedy based on Henry Fielding's novel, can love conquer all?
